US House votes to let ISPs sell your browser history

Share

With a slim majority of 215 to 205, the US House of Representatives just passed a resolution rolling back FCC privacy regulations. Approved last year, the rules required that ISPs get your explicit permission before selling sensitive data like your browsing history. The resolution already passed the Senate last week, and now will go before the President, who has said he plans to sign it.
